Python多线程练习

import time
from concurrent.futures import ThreadPoolExecutor, as_completed
from concurrent.futures import ProcessPoolExecutor

def fib(n):
    if n<=2:
        return 1
    return fib(n-1)+fib(n-2)


with ProcessPoolExecutor(3) as executor:
    all_task = [executor.submit(fib,num) for num in range(25,35)]
    start_time = time.time()
    for future in as_completed(all_task):
        data = future.result()
        print('get {} page'.format(data))

    print('last time is:{}'.format(time.time()-start_time))
import multiprocessing
import os
import time


def get_html(n):
    time.sleep(n)
    print('sub_progress success')
    return n


if __name__ == '__main__':
    # progress = multiprocessing.Process(target=get_html,args=(2,))
    # progress.start()
    # progress.join()
    # print('main progress end')


    pool = multiprocessing.Pool(multiprocessing.cpu_count())
    result = pool.apply_async(get_html, args=(3,))

    #等待所有任务完成
    pool.close()
    pool.join()
    print(result.get())
